Anyone Have Federal BCBS?
I'm not sure about being disqualified for losing weight during the diet. I only lost a couple of pounds during mine because I wasn't sure either. My weigh ins during the 3 months were fairly consistent, within a few pounds. I understand about the losing/ regaining..... I've always had that problem too. Frustrating! I lost 50 pounds a few years ago and gained it all back, plus 30. Ugh My out of pocket was co pays for all PCP visits ($30 each) co pays for the surgeons visits ($40 each, only 2 of those) $175 for the NUT one on one consult, $200 for surgeon fee (for performing the surgery) , co pay for the physc ($25), co pay for pre op ($40), $175 for 1 night in hospital. I had to see a cardiologist once because of my age, ($40) The NUT classes were free. So, about $825 hope this helps

Anyone Have Federal BCBS?
I have Fed BCBS basic. I just got approved and am having my surgery on Wednesday. Their requirements are a BMI of at least 35 or above. If your BMI is over 35 but under 40, then you must have at least 2 comorbities such as high blood pressure, high cholesterol, diabetes, sleep apnea. 40 and above BMI doesn't require any comorbitiy. They require 3 months (in a row) of a supervised diet plan with your physician , a referral and letter of medical neccessity from your physician and a history of obesity. Because of the required 3 month supervised diet it takes at least that long for approval. My gastric surgeon's practice is the one who required the NUT, Physc eval, and a few classes. It sounds daunting, but it wasn't that bad. I started in July and good approved in November. Mine took that long because of the 3 months consecutive appointments that were needed with my doc.
